| Factory | Number |
|---|---|
| MARELLI | mt68p |
| MARELLI | 63216876 |
| ISKRA | IS 0201 |
| LESTER | 17326 |
| NASTRA | 17326 |
| MARELLI | 63216814 |
| USA In... | 17326 |
Descripition:
Brand:MARELLI
Part Number(s):MT68P
ProductName:Starter
NISSAN 21487JF01A
PERFECT CIRCLE 260-1320 Suspension Ball Joint
NAPA 2422234 Disc Brake Caliper
RENAULT T0622407
NISSAN 545019Z555 Suspension Ball Joint
FORD 9C345005BD
GM 26096193 Air Bag Clockspring
DELPHI SS10203 Sensor
KAWE 341496 Brake Caliper
SWF 104500 Wiper Linkage
BIG A 96776 Cabin Air Filter
SAAB 3657297087 Air Filter